NO more smoking on-campus in Illinois as of July 1, 2015. Governor Pat Quinn signed the "Smoke Free Campus Act" on Sunday. The law will ban smoking in both indoor and outdoor spaces on state-supported college and university campuses starting July 1, 2015. This will not affect private colleges or Universities

Gov Quinn told the Chicago Tribune

Illinois' college students shouldn't be subject to unwanted cigarette smoke on the campuses they call home, we want all schools to be healthy, clean and productive places of learning for Illinois' bright young minds. This new law will improve the health of our students and encourage healthier lifestyles after college graduation."

The text of the law states that smoking will still be allowed inside cars traveling through campus. The law also provides a few exceptions.
